Petrel team visits PNG "Black Jack" B-17F wreck (41-24521)

Thu Apr 05, 2018 4:55 pm

It apparently took some delicate maneuvering, but on a recent visit to Papua New Guinea, Paul Allen's R/V Petrel team dropped their high tech ROV on the near shore wreck of B-17F-20-BO "Black Jack/The Joker's Wild" (S/N 41-24521).
